Youjia Chen received the B.S. and M.S degrees in communication engineering from Nanjing University, Nanjing, China, and Ph.D. in wireless engineering from the University of Sydney, Australia, in 2005, 2008, and 2017, respectively. From 2008-2009, she worked in Alcatel-Lucent Shanghai Bell. Then she worked at the College of Photonic and Electrical Engineering, Fujian Normal University, China, from Aug. 2009. Currently, she is a professor at the College of Physics and Information Engineering, Fuzhou University, China. She has published over 30 research papers in leading international journals and conferences and contributed to a Wiley-IEEE Press book. Her research interests include wireless caching/computing, intelligent reflecting surfaces, Internet of video things, and wireless AI.
